Bachelor of Science in Psychology at WSU Pullman Overview
Bachelor of Science in Psychology offered at Washington State University is a UG level course, which is considered the top-ranked course across the university and the country. Students who are willing to apply, can pursue the course within the duration of 4 years.
International students applying at Washington State University for this course, need to submit the necessary documents as per the department and the course. International students need to submit qualification proofs along with test scores of exams including IELTS, TOEFL, PTE, Duolingo and SAT.
The Washington State University tuition fees for Bachelor of Science in Psychology for the first-year international student is USD 28,442. In addition to the tuition fees students need to look into other various factors that are necessary to manage their stay during the study at the university, which include the other necessary costs, covering accommodation costs, hostel fees, food, books, supplies, utilities, etc. The average cost of living at Washington State University is USD 13,262.

Bachelor of Science in Psychology at WSU Pullman Entry Requirements
- CGPA - 2.7/4
- Read less
- Applicant must complete at least 12 years of school, culminating in an appropriate secondary/high school certificate or external examination
- minimum 2.70 grade point average (GPA) on a 4.00 scale
- Preparation in humanities, mathematics, basic sciences, and social sciences
- The first year or two of university study in some countries may be secondary-level
- Subject required:
-
- English- 4 years
- Math- 3 years (Must include algebra II, integrated math III, or above)
- Senior year math-based quantitative course
- Science- 3 years, 2 years of lab
- Social sciences- 3 years
- World language- 2 years of the same language (ASL included)
- Fine arts- 1 year
- Applicant must complete at least 12 years of school, culminating in an appropriate secondary/high school certificate or external examination

Bachelor of Science in Psychology at WSU Pullman Highlights
- Psychology is the scientific study of behavior and the mental processes that determine behavior
- Psychology also applies the accumulated knowledge of this science to solve practical problems
- Students can focus on their training in select specialized areas (these are not majors or degrees):
Biological psychology/neuroscience
Child development
Clinical neuropsychology
General clinical psychology
Learning and cognition
Social psychology - The Bachelor of Science in Psychology requires a minimum of 35 credits in PSYCH, at least 15 of which must be in 300-400-level courses
